Member page

This commit is contained in:
cdricms
2025-02-05 09:11:17 +01:00
parent 0595f5dba7
commit 09b0c9b142
12 changed files with 372 additions and 95 deletions

View File

@@ -1,12 +1,15 @@
FROM golang:alpine
FROM golang:alpine AS build
WORKDIR /app
COPY . .
RUN go mod download
RUN go mod tidy
RUN go build main.go
RUN go build -o /app .
CMD ["./main"]
FROM scratch AS final
COPY --from=build /app /app
CMD ["/app"]